Professional Quality At a Great Price
|
|
Posted .
This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.
I'm a professional portrait photographer who was tired of the inaccuracy of the track pad and the unnatural feel of editing with a mouse. My friend has used Wacom for years and I actually had an old Wacom tablet that she sold me and loved it.
Well recently, I revamped my equipment and editing system. I purchased a new MacBook Pro, new camera equipment, and this Wacom tablet for use with photoshop and Lightroom. This little tablet is amazing!
I know there are multiple tiers of quality in these Wacom tablets, ranging from the novice artist or editor, up to the professionals that probably have wacoms built into their desk. I may have splurged on my business, but I still had a budget.
At just around $100, this thing does more than I expected it to! Not only is it accurate and is calibrated true to the screen, but is also has function buttons that can be mapped to specific actions for all your different apps! My favorite feature, though, is the touch sensitivity. When I'm editing a photo in Lightroom, sometimes I like to put a more subtle version of the effect or overlay I'm working with. Normally, I'd have to adjust the flow on the task bar and edit the bleed radius, etc. With this tablet, the flow is determined by how lightly or hard you press your pen to the surface. This saving me A LOT of extra time. My workflow is so streamlined now, that it's already paid for itself, thanks to my shorter turnaround times on edits and prints!

I would have given it 5 stars but Wacom didn't include an eraser tip on the other end of the pen/stylus. I miss that piece of functionality.
Also, I believe the difference between the Intuos Draw and this (Art) unit is that this (Art) unit supports touch/gestures. I leave the touch portion turned off. Had I known this was the only difference I would have probably saved $30 and just bought the Draw unit.
Still, overall, it works great!
